In a disturbing incident that has shaken Gurgaon, a woman is fighting for her life after being shot by a male friend whose romantic advances she had repeatedly rejected. The attack occurred in the upscale Sector 53 area, exposing the dark side of a friendship that turned deadly when affection wasn't reciprocated.
The Fateful Confession That Triggered Violence
The victim, a 25-year-old woman, had known the accused for several years. Their friendship took a dramatic turn when the man expressed his desire to marry her. According to police reports, the woman clearly communicated her disinterest in taking their relationship beyond friendship.
"When she firmly turned down his proposal and began distancing herself, the accused couldn't handle the rejection," revealed a senior police officer investigating the case.
The Violent Aftermath of Rejection
What began as an unrequited romantic interest quickly escalated into a dangerous obsession. The accused, identified as a resident of Gurgaon, began harassing the woman persistently. When she stopped responding to his messages and calls to maintain boundaries, he decided to take extreme measures.
On the day of the incident, the man confronted the woman near her residence. Witnesses reported heated arguments before the situation turned violent. In a fit of rage, the accused pulled out a pistol and fired at the woman at close range.
Immediate Police Response and Investigation
Local residents alerted the police immediately after hearing gunshots. The victim was rushed to a nearby private hospital where she underwent emergency surgery. Doctors confirmed she sustained critical injuries but is currently in stable condition.
"We have registered a case under appropriate sections of the IPC and Arms Act," stated the investigating officer. "The accused has been identified and teams are working to apprehend him at the earliest."
